The Role of Loaded Carries in Stability and Power

vertshock.com

Loaded carries, commonly used in strength training, are dynamic exercises that require carrying a weighted object over a distance. While they primarily target grip strength, loaded carries also play a vital role in enhancing stability, core strength, and overall power. Understanding how these benefits transfer to athletic performance, especially in basketball, can elevate training and unlock higher potential in various movements, from jumping to changing directions quickly.

1. Core Stability and Bracing

At their core, loaded carries engage nearly every muscle group, but the key benefit lies in the core. When carrying a heavy load, the body must work to stabilize and support the spine, leading to improvements in core bracing. The trunk muscles (such as the abdominals, obliques, and lower back) work together to maintain an upright posture and prevent excessive rotation or lateral bending. For basketball players, a strong and stable core translates to more controlled movements, better balance while shooting, and enhanced resistance to contact during physical play.

The added resistance challenges the body’s ability to maintain posture, forcing the core to stay engaged for extended periods. This builds endurance in the stabilizing muscles, which is critical for maintaining form throughout an entire game or practice.

2. Upper Body Strength and Endurance

The loaded carry requires significant upper body involvement, especially the shoulders, arms, and grip. The forearms are constantly engaged, enhancing grip strength over time. For basketball players, this means better control over the ball, improved handling during fast-paced plays, and the ability to maintain possession even under pressure.

Additionally, the shoulders and upper traps are worked during the carry, which aids in improving posture and upper body endurance. Whether in a defensive stance or during a jump, the endurance of the upper body muscles is vital for sustained performance.

3. Hip and Lower Body Activation

Although the core and upper body are key players in loaded carries, the lower body also gets significant activation. As you walk with a heavy load, the legs and hips assist in maintaining a stable stance. The glutes, quads, and hamstrings work to power through each step, while the hip flexors and adductors help stabilize the movement. This strengthens the lower body muscles, improving force production during vertical jumps and explosiveness on the court.

For athletes, especially basketball players, loaded carries mimic the actions of pushing and stabilizing under load, which are essential when driving past an opponent, jumping, or changing directions quickly.

4. Cross-Body Coordination and Anti-Rotation

Loaded carries often involve walking with a weight in one hand (as in a suitcase carry or farmer’s walk) or in both hands. This forces the body to resist rotation and anti-lateral bending as the load shifts. This resistance to rotational forces activates the deep stabilizers of the torso, such as the transverse abdominis and obliques. For basketball players, this helps develop the ability to resist unwanted rotations during movements like pivoting, driving to the basket, or even when being pressured by defenders.

6. Improved Posture and Injury Prevention

Loaded carries reinforce proper posture by forcing the body to align itself under a load. The chest stays lifted, and the shoulders remain back, helping to develop better posture habits. For basketball players, poor posture can lead to inefficient movements and an increased risk of injury. Loaded carries counteract the negative effects of poor posture and help prevent injuries by strengthening muscles that stabilize the joints.

For example, shoulder and back injuries are common in basketball due to repetitive overhead movements and sudden twisting. The improved muscle endurance and posture from loaded carries help create a more robust and injury-resistant body.

8. Types of Loaded Carries for Basketball Performance

  • Farmer’s Carry: This involves holding a weight in each hand while walking. It’s excellent for building grip strength, shoulder stability, and endurance.

  • Suitcase Carry: Carrying a weight on one side of the body challenges the core to resist rotation, improving anti-rotational strength and stability.

  • Overhead Carry: Holding a weight overhead while walking strengthens the shoulders, traps, and core while increasing posture and endurance.

  • Rack Carry: This involves holding a weight in a “rack position,” which is similar to the position of a barbell during a front squat. It strengthens the upper back, shoulders, and core while reinforcing a stable, upright posture.
